Fake Bank Apps Suspected for Stealing Customers’ Data

A number of fake apps of top banks including Citi, Axis Bank, ICICI, and SBI are available on Google Play store. According to a report by IT security firm Sophos Labs, these apps may have stolen sensitive information about thousands of customers. 

The report said that the fake apps have logos of the banks which trick customers into believing that they are genuine apps. When asked about these apps, some banks said they aren’t aware of them, while others started an inquiry about them and informed CERT-In.
